In the world of wireless communication, remote controls play a vital role in our everyday lives From operating garage doors to controlling electronic devices, remote controls have become an essential tool for convenience and efficiency One of the most commonly used frequencies for remote controls is 433.92 MHz This frequency has gained popularity due to its reliability, range, and compatibility with a wide range of devices.
Remote control 433.92 MHz operates on the industrial, scientific, and medical (ISM) band, which allows for non-licensed use in various applications This frequency provides a balance between range and power consumption, making it ideal for wireless communication devices With a wavelength of approximately 69 cm, 433.92 MHz signals can penetrate walls and obstacles, making them suitable for indoor and outdoor use.
One of the key advantages of remote control 433.92 MHz is its compatibility with a wide range of devices Many garage door openers, gate operators, car alarms, and home automation systems use this frequency for remote control operation This compatibility allows users to control multiple devices with a single remote control, making it convenient and user-friendly.
